/*
Theme Name: Hello Elementor Child
Theme URI: https://github.com/elementor/hello-theme/
Description: Hello Elementor Child is a child theme of Hello Elementor, created by Elementor team
Author: Elementor Team
Author URI: https://elementor.com/
Template: hello-elementor
Version: 1.0.1
Text Domain: hello-elementor-child
License: GNU General Public License v3 or later.
License URI: https://www.gnu.org/licenses/gpl-3.0.html
Tags: flexible-header, custom-colors, custom-menu, custom-logo, editor-style, featured-images, rtl-language-support, threaded-comments, translation-ready
*/

.tribe-events-pro-map__event-details {
    overflow: hidden;
    padding-right: 5px;
}

@media (min-width: 768px) {
    .tribe-events-venue-map {
        width: 430px;
    }
}

.tribe-events-pro-map__event-card-button h3 {
    white-space: normal;
}

.tribe-events-meta-group-other {
    display: none;
}

.
.tribe-address span {
    display: block;
}

.tribe-address .tribe-delimiter {
    display: none;
}

.tribe-address br {
    display: none;
}

.select2-container--default .selection, .select2-container--default .selection .select2-selection {
    width: 100%
}

#event_tribe_event_status {
    display: none;
}

#participate-form .tribe-section td {
    background-color: unset !important;
}

#event_tribe_venue {
    padding-right: 0px !important;
}


#event_tribe_venue .saved-linked-post, #event_tribe_organizer .saved-linked-post {
    display: none;
}

.tribe-events-virtual-video-sources-wrap, .tribe-events-virtual-video-source-autodetect__button-wrapper {
    display: none;
}

#tribe-virtual-events > tbody > tr:nth-last-child(2) {
    display: none;
}

#tribe-virtual-events > tbody > tr:last-child {
    display: none;
}

.tribe-events-virtual-type-of-event .tribe-table-field-label, .tribe-events-virtual-type-of-event ul {
    visibility: hidden;
    height: 0px;
}

.tribe-events-virtual-display__list {
    width: 100% !important;
    max-width: unset !important;
}

.virtual-event-wrapper.eventtable .tribe-events-virtual-display__linked-button-text-input {
    flex: unset !important;
    margin-top: -10px !important;
}

.virtual-event-wrapper.eventtable .tribe-events-virtual-type-of-event td {
    padding-bottom: 0 !important;
    padding-top: 0 !important;
}

.tribe-community-events td, #select2-EventCountry-container, .select2-results__option, .tribe-community-events .select2-results__option, .tribe-community-events .select2-selection__choice, .tribe-community-events label, .tribe-community-events input, .tribe-community-events textarea, .tribe-community-events p {
    font-size: 13pt !important;
}

.tetractys-linked-row {
    display: table-row;
}


.tribe-community-events .tribe-section .tribe-field-type-checkbox label input[type=checkbox], .tribe-community-events .tribe-section .tribe-field-type-radio label input[type=checkbox] {
    vertical-align: sub;
}

.ui-datepicker select.ui-datepicker-month {
    width: 100% !important;
    float: left;
}

.ui-datepicker select.ui-datepicker-year {
    display: none;
    float: left;
}


.tribe-community-events input:not(#tribe-events-virtual-virtual-button-text, .tribe-datepicker , .tribe-timepicker, [type='checkbox'], [type='radio']), .tribe-community-events textarea {
    width: 100% !important;
}

.tribe-events-pro .tribe-events-pro-map__event-cards-scroll-pane {
    width: 8px !important;
}

.tribe-filter-bar .tribe-filter-bar-c-pill--button .tribe-filter-bar-c-pill__pill:focus, .tribe-filter-bar .tribe-filter-bar-c-pill--button .tribe-filter-bar-c-pill__pill:hover {
    background-color: #333 !important;
    border-color: #000 !important;
}


tr.recurrence-row {
    display:none;
}

.elementor-30 .elementor-element.elementor-element-6c4b457  {
    display: none !important;
}